Along with the basic decision about materials, there are questions about maintenance and lifespan and cost. Either metal based fences and wood are fine more or less, and what matters to you most is what you should use as a guideline. Some people just think that wood has a better look and feel to it and so they use that as their personal criteria.

While shopping for the ideal fence, you do want to pay attention and ask about the warranty. What you will always find is that a contractor may not say much about this, and that's why you really need to bring that up early in the discussion before you buy anything.
